Suzy and the tricycle (Posted on 2004-02-24) Difficulty: 1 of 5
Little Suzy has a tricycle (you know, with three wheels). She wants to travel 1 mile with the tricycle, but she wants to spare her tyres (you know the price on tricycle tyres just keep going up). She is taking 2 spare tyres.

Assume she knows when to exchange wheels so that each of them travels an equal distance. How far does each wheel travel at the end of one mile? How did she exchange the wheels?

How far does each wheel travel at the end of one mile?
3/5 of a mile on the axle, and 2/5 on the rack. for a total of 1 mile.
 
How did she exchange the wheels?
With a tire iron.
 
Explanation:
 
She starts out with main tires a, b, c, and spares d,e.
 
She goes the first 1/5 mile with tires a,b,c on the vehicle.
Then she replaces a with d.
She goes the second 1/5 mile on d,b,c.
Then she replaces b with e.
She goes the third 1/5 mile on d,e,c, 
Then she replaces c with a.
She goes the fourth 1/5 mile on d,e,a.
Then she replaces d with b
She goes the final 1/5 mile on b,e,a.
